**Construction Project Manager**
Position Description
The Project Manager is responsible for planning, executing, and overseeing projects from start to finish, ensuring they are completed on time and within budget expectations. Working in partnership with the site superintendent, the Project Manager is responsible for inspecting and reviewing projects in progress to enforce compliance with plans, permits, specifications, building and safety codes, and is expected to proactively manage subcontractor and owner expectations and responsibilities to full completion of the project(s). A successful Project Manager will be capable of applying extensive knowledge of principles and processes to provide client satisfaction in meeting quality, cost and schedule expectations.
Responsibilities Include
ü Manage all on site construction related activities, subcontractors, and vendors.
ü Prepare purchase order and subcontract drafts for approval.
ü RFI correspondence to owners and subcontractors.
ü Interpret and clarify plans and contract terms to subcontractors professionally.
ü Obtain all project related permits and licenses from proper authorities.
ü Ensure SWMP and environmental requirements are met.
ü Compile & submit monthly owner billings.
ü Review and approve subcontractor and vendor pay requisitions.
ü Negotiate and manage the change order process with Owners and subcontractors.
ü Develop project budget and schedules and the management of both with cost to complete analysis and timely and accurate CPM updates.

Qualifications/Skills
- Bachelor's degree in construction management or similar with 2-5 years of construction experience
- Strategic, collaborative self-starter who is creative, persistent and results-driven
- Hold extensive knowledge of materials, methods, processes, procedures, and equipment involved in civil infrastructure and related site work.
- Strong ability to read and understand plans and specifications, comprehensive knowledge of commercial construction means, methods and best practices and related systems
- Ability to Evaluate plans, specifications and related construction documents for "Constructability"
- Strong leadership and communication skills
- Acute attention to detail in a professional atmosphere
- Demonstrate ability to multi-task
- Proficient in Microsoft applications and Procore Management System
